Job description

Virgin Galactic is hiring a Sr. Mechanical Engineer with a background in Hardware Integration for Aerospace and/or Space applications, including for new development as well as in-service programs.

 

This position will be primarily based out of our Spaceport America hangar in Truth or Consequences, NM with regular travel to our new Spaceship Factory in Phoenix-Mesa, Arizona. This is a fantastic opportunity to work with all our unique and cutting-edge vehicles, to include our Spaceship 2 Unity, Mothership Eve, and our next generation of Spaceships, the Delta class. You will be creating innovative designs that meet our demanding requirements through prototyping, hands-on design and working directly with technicians on the vehicle as a part of our standard practice. You will have the opportunity to collaborate and coordinate with multiple groups, including structural integrity, systems, structures, production control, and supply chain.
